A self-adhesive label specialist is on the search for a talented, driven professional to head up their sales team.
Dynamic, energetic and passionate about the work you do, you will be eager to bring fresh ideas to the table and improve company turnover. Coming from a labels background with successful experience as a senior sales representative or sales manager, you will be able to offer invaluable advice to both staff and clients.
With demonstrated capability to communicate, present and influence credibly and effectively to all levels of the organisation, and a proven ability to drive the sales process from plan to close, your key responsibilities will include the following:
- Design and implement a strategic business plan that expands company’s customer base and ensure its strong presence
- Manage recruiting, set objectives, coach and monitor performance of sales staff
- Build and promote strong, long-lasting customer relationships by thoroughly understanding their needs
- Present sales reports and realistic forecasts to company directors
- Identify emerging markets and market shifts while being fully aware of new products and competition status
This role requires not only a charismatic leader with excellent mentoring, coaching and people management skills, but also someone with strong business sense and an abundance of industry experience.
Due to the structure of the business, this role offers an excellent career progression opportunity for an individual who is ambitious and able to deliver results.
